Mental Health Association of Greater Chicago, founded in 1957, is a small nonprofit that reported $287K in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Revenue surged 30%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. The organization ran a surplus of $76K, a strong 26% operating margin.

Mission

Providing enhanced mental and emotional wellness in our communities by delivering education collaboration and support programs
